When crossing chunk borders I experience harsh spikes in frame time, which are visible in the Alt + F3 graph. These spikes occur every time without fail. They seem to happen everywhere whether I'm in the sky, on the surface, or underground. However, I've noticed the spikes are significantly worse on the surface compared to when I'm underground. For some reason I experience extremely poor performance on the surface (between 60-120 FPS) compared to when I'm underground or tunneling (between 800-1200+ FPS), which is a bit strange as I'm running one of the most high end setups available.
